Slate

Slate is a fine-grained metamorphic rock formed from shale under low-grade metamorphism. It splits into thin, flat sheets and has been used for roofing, flooring, and writing surfaces for centuries. Slate's ability to split into thin layers makes it unique among rocks.

Physical Properties of Slate

TextureFoliated (splits into thin sheets)
ColorsGray, black, green, purple, red
MagnetismNon-magnetic
Grain SizeVery fine-grained
Hardness3-4
Density2.6-2.9 g/cm³

Chemical Properties of Slate

Main Elements:

Si, Al, K, Fe, O

Chemical Composition:

Similar to shale: clay minerals, quartz, and mica recrystallized under pressure

Health Risk of Slate

Slate dust can cause respiratory irritation. Generally safe to handle, but wear masks when cutting.

Characteristics of Slate

Density:

2.6-2.9 g/cm³

Compressive Strength:

100-200 MPa

Melting Point:

Variable

Formation:

Forms when shale is subjected to low-grade metamorphism (heat and pressure), causing the clay minerals to recrystallize and align into parallel layers.

Composition:

Composed of fine-grained mica, quartz, and clay minerals that have been recrystallized under pressure.

Types:

  • Roofing Slate
  • Writing Slate
  • Flagstone Slate

Etymology:

Derived from the Old French word "esclate" meaning "splinter" or "fragment", referring to its tendency to split into thin sheets.

Cultural Significance of Slate

Uses:

  • Roofing
  • Flooring
  • Writing surfaces (blackboards)
  • Billiard tables
  • Decorative stone

Distribution:

Found worldwide, especially in Wales, Spain, Brazil, and the eastern United States

Historical Use:

Used for roofing and writing surfaces for centuries. School blackboards were originally made of slate!

Frequently Asked Questions

Why does slate split into thin sheets?

Slate splits into thin sheets because the minerals have been recrystallized and aligned into parallel layers under pressure, creating planes of weakness.

What is slate used for?

Slate is used for roofing, flooring, writing surfaces (blackboards), billiard tables, and decorative stone due to its ability to split into thin, flat sheets.
